This checklist supports safe and compliant tie-in welds for pipeline work. It covers safety prerequisites such as a completed JHA, hot work permit, and identification of the clearance supervisor. It lists essential welding materials and tools, and verifies welder certification and procedure compliance. Quality controls include pipe prep, preheat, visual acceptance criteria for undercut and high spots, and verification steps like leak checks and x-ray testing. Use it to document inspections and confirm work meets PGE standard and project requirements.
